Estimated Travel Time
- Distance: Approx. 215 km
- Duration: 2 hours 45 minutes to 3 hours
Traffic conditions may slightly affect timing, especially near Milan.

Best Attractions in Bardi
🏰 Bardi Castle (Castello di Bardi)
The crown jewel of the town.
- Built on a red jasper rock
- Panoramic views of the valley
- Legends of ghosts and knights
🌿 Ceno Valley Nature Trails
Perfect for hiking and photography.
- Forest paths
- River views
- Fresh mountain air
⛪ Cathedral of San Giovanni Battista
A beautiful religious landmark.
- Romanesque design
- Quiet spiritual atmosphere

Pro Travel Tips for Milan Malpensa to Bardi
Best Time to Visit
- Spring (April–June): Mild weather, green landscapes
- Autumn (September–October): Food festivals, fewer crowds
Summer is warm but beautiful.
Winter is quiet and romantic.
Local Customs to Know
- Lunch is sacred in small towns
- Shops may close midday
- Greetings matter
A smile goes a long way.
